The Crown’s Fate is the spellbinding sequel to Evelyn Skye’s bestselling debut novel, The Crown’s Game. In this thrilling continuation of the story, we are once again transported to the enchanting world of Imperial Russia, where magic and mayhem collide in a battle for power and love.

The Crown’s Fate picks up where The Crown’s Game left off, with Vika, Nikolai, and Pasha grappling with the aftermath of the game that tore their friendship apart. Vika is now the Imperial Enchanter, tasked with using her magic to protect the kingdom. Nikolai is a dark and brooding figure, consumed by his desire for revenge. And Pasha is the tsar, torn between his duty to his kingdom and his love for Vika.

As tensions rise and loyalties are tested, Vika, Nikolai, and Pasha must choose where their allegiances lie and what sacrifices they are willing to make for the ones they love. The stakes are higher than ever, and the fate of the kingdom hangs in the balance.
